I need a way to clean silver jewelry to remove the black oxidation.
This was originally a shiney heart from Tiffanys in NYC. All silver jewelry does this on me unless the content is .625! Please help! How do I clean this silver jewelr... See more
Hi Meritt, this is Peggy. Hope this is helpful for you to clean your silver jewelry..Rub the jewelry, then rinse in cool water and buff with a cloth until dry. For heavier tarnish, mix a paste of three parts baking soda to one part water. Wet thesilver and apply the cleaner with a soft, lint-free cloth (not paper towels, which can scratch).Nov 20, 2018

I use a small amount of toothpaste and a toothbrush I no longer use to polish my silver jewelry. It works great. Put a little dab of paste on the brush and gently rub on the piece of jewelry and then wash off in cool water. Use a lint free cotton cloth to dry jewelry.
